Josh Harrold

Principal

Josh Harrold, AIA, is a Principal at BNIM with nearly two decades of experience creating a body of work that has earned regional and national recognition. His practice bridges architecture, planning, and cultural storytelling, consistently working at the intersection of landscape, architecture, interiors, and technology to deepen the relationship between people and place. Josh brings a regionalist’s sensibility and a modernist’s approach to every endeavor, shaping spaces as living biographies of the communities they serve. His process is rooted in thorough analysis, rigorous investigation, and meticulous execution — blending strategic thinking with deep empathy. Most recently, Josh has applied this approach to transformative projects including Missouri State University’s Blunt Hall Renovation and Addition, the Springfield Art Museum and Master Plan, the adaptive reuse of the former Lyric Theatre in Downtown Kansas City into the Kirk Family YMCA, and the Kansas City International Airport Parking Garage.
